
When people got busy with their jobs and women started to work eating out started also to increase as well. Restaurants increased in number and provide us with a variety of choices. Seafood, Italian, Chinese, Japanese, American and so on. All of these reasons made cooking at home be difficult and hard to implement. So restaurants became a solution for these problems.
What happened next was interesting! A revolution came .. people started to prepare their meals again. That happened because three reasons. The first, rising of awareness. People came to know that how much is the quality and the way of cooking food may effect your health “you are what you eat”. The second was money issues, costs became too high and the income is not enough. The third, missing the taste of home made meals.
The question here is how to reach that and in the same time cook something easy, simple and delicious (compared with top restaurants)? This was an issue. So a need of recipes resources increased. A lot of cooking books were published, and still the number increases every year. Cooking websites and blogs have been created. Magazines articles and TV shows were also involved. All media types are talking about one topic cooking.
Cooking became an art more than three meals everyday. An art every body enjoy, kids, adults, teenagers, men and women. The first technique I’m introducing today is Preparing and Cooking Ahead.
The best thing about many dishes is that they can be prepared in advance and cooked when required. This advantage do two things, the first keep stress levels low. The second, ensures that success levels remain high.
Let us start with dishes that does not require cooking such as Salads. In this types of dishes preparation is the critical point. In this case you can wash the salad leaves and dry them, one leave at the time. Then bag and put in the refrigerator”personally after drying I will cover them with paper towels”. This step will not ensure only that the leaves are ready at the last minute, but it also will make them become crisper on standing.
Although that is good to speed up the preparing the salad dish, but the valuable nutrients will be lost. So my advice is to use the advanced preparation only when you know you will be in a hurry later.
Dishes like stews, curries and casseroles often benefit form being made a day before they are to be served. This allows time for the flavors of the different ingredients to meld.So you can cook dishes like this even further ahead and freeze them.
Some points should be considered before freezing any dish. First, the food must be cold before being placed in the freezer. So if you have a hot dish or a hot pot let it cool down first, then place it in a sink full of a very cold or even iced water. That will accelerate the chilling process. Although some dishes can be used in ovens and in freezers but it is not recommended to switch between the two without allowing the hot food to cool or the frozen food to thaw.The best way to let frozen food thaw is to place it in the refrigerator overnight.
When you want to freeze a meal, cool food rapidly then wrap securely and label with a description, date, and number of servings. That will make it easier for you to remember what you have in your freezer and for how long.
Soups and stews in most cases freeze well, but if they contain chopped potatoes, rice, barley or pasta you will notice that they will become mushy while freezing and will lose texture. To prevent that add them after thawing, then simmer the soup or stew until these ingredients are fully cooked. Also don’t forget to leave a little head room in the container to allow the liquid to expand during freezing.
Before freezing dishes that contains fat, try to remove any surplus fat before freezing; especially for long time freezing. It is well known that fat will become rancid in long time freezing.
For any meat or poultry dishes that includes sauce or gravy, make sure that the meat or poultry pieces are fully dipped into the liquid. That will reduce of drying out in the freezer.
For fish in sauce, the taste after freezing and reheating will not be the same as the original taste, Although it can be frozen. So the best thing to do with dishes like this, is to prepare them in the same day of serving.
If you want to freeze rice it is recommended to to be cooled quickly and thoroughly after cooking and before storing. And do not keep cooked rice warm for long periods. When you want to preheat it make sure that it is very hot and serve immediately. These precautions will help to avoid food poisoning.
